Abstract

A golf ball 1 has a core 2 and a cover 3 . For molding a core 2 , a rubber composition is extruded from a kneading machine, and cut at a predetermined length to obtain a preforming material. The preforming material is placed in a mold and the mold is clamped. An upper portion and lower portion of the mold mate for more than or equal to 15 seconds, and thereafter they are unclamped until a clearance between the upper and lower portions becomes from 3 mm to 8 mm, then, the mold is shut. The shutting time is determined to be from 0.5 second to 5.0 seconds. By this unclamping of the mold, a residual air in a spherical cavity is released, which results in elimination of defective products.

Claims (10)

1. A method for manufacturing a golf ball comprising the steps of;

a preforming step to form a preforming material which is substantially cylindrically shaped and is made of a rubber composition;

a placing step to place the preforming material in a mold comprising an upper portion and a lower portion both of which have a hemispherical cavity;

a clamping step wherein the lower portion is mated to the upper portion;

an unclamping step wherein after mating of the upper and lower portions for more than or equal to 15 seconds during the clamping step, the lower portion moves relatively apart from the upper portion so that a clearance between the upper and lower portions becomes from 3 mm to 8 mm;

a crosslinking step wherein the lower portion is again mated to the upper portion so that a crosslinking reaction initiates; and,

a removing step wherein the mold is opened to remove a sphere from the cavity.

2. The method for manufacturing a golf ball according to claim 1 , wherein a diameter of a sphere removed during the removing step is from 20 mm to 45 mm.

3. The method for manufacturing a golf ball according to claim 1 , wherein a time period from when the upper portion and the lower portion start to move apart from each other during the unclamping step until when the upper and lower portions mate again is from 0.5 second to 5.0 seconds.

4. The method for molding a golf ball according to claim 3 , wherein a diameter of a sphere removed during the removing step is from 20 mm to 45 mm.
